Logotherapy, developed by Viktor Frankl (a neurologist and psychiatrist) is based on the principle that the primary motivational force for any individual is to find meaning in life. More than power or pleasure, logotherapy drives humans to find purpose in life. Therefore, logotherapy is "healing through meaning", a meaning-centred approach to life.

Each person is a unique and irreplaceable human being whose existence is characterized by freedom of choice, personal responsibility, and a human spirit.

The core principles of logotherapy are:
(1) Freedom of Will–We can choose how we respond to life and are personally responsible for our choices.
(2) Will to Meaning – We are motivated to find meaning, and when this search is upset, we experience existential frustration and feelings of meaninglessness.
(3) Meaning of Life–We are called moment-to-moment to answer the demands that life places on us.

The focus is not on what we feel we deserve from life but on our responsibility to give to life. We have the ability and the ultimate necessity to self-transcend to improve humanity.

The Japanese concept "ikigai" which translates roughly as "the happiness of always being busy," is like logotherapy, but it goes a step beyond. It also seems to be one way of explaining the extraordinary longevity of the Japanese, especially on the island of Okinawa, where there are 24.55 people over the age of 100 for every 100,000 inhabitants- far more than the global average.

Ask these questions yourself, "Am I adding meaning to my life ? Is life adding meaning to me ?" Life is a constant search for meaning. Some find it early, while others don't. Life is a gift from God, and what you do with your life will be a gift to God in return. No one of us deserves life, but God has given us as a gift.

We should be grateful for this most beautiful gift on earth. Life is a stage between non-existence and death. Death can become the beginning of our non-existence. Life is a brief period. We need to give meaning to this short life. We don't know when the death knell will call us. It is an unpredictable journey. Therefore, we have to make meaning with this short time.

We constantly daydream. We continuously create a world that doesn't exist. When some external force offers meaning, we become mere slaves to that definition of life. However, life becomes meaningful when we create, re-create, invent, re-invent, find, re-find, define, and re-define our lives through the up and down experiences.

The meaning of life is to give sense to whatever happens to self. This is accepting what comes and dealing with it. If you see life as a problem, then you have only problems. If you see life as a programme, you have plenty of time to attend all the programmes and enjoy the fun. It depends much on how you look at life.
